Up photo Ashington fears it May run out of room for monuments Washington up the nation s capital is full of monuments memorials statues and plaques and fears that the government May be running out of room to Honor future heroes. Although the nation is Little More than 200 years old there Are already 111 statues plaques buildings and Gar Dens on Federal land in the District of Columbia area to commemorate people and events in . History. They include numerous War heroes 11 presidents inventors an statesmen. The tally does not include various statues and buildings erected on private land or land owned by the City of Washington . Nor does it take into account the Navy me Morial under construction on Pennsylvania Avenue the Franklin Delano Roosevelt memorial Garden that has been approved but not paid for or statues being planned to Honor american Law enforcement heroes and the Poe Kahil Gibran. The existing National monuments Range from the under stated and Little noticed Granite Block in front of the National archives building in Honor of for to the breath taking Lincoln memorial that attracted More than 3 million visitors last year. In keeping with the words inscribed at the Entrance of the National archives what is past is prologue the monuments Are meant to be a testimony to our history and our Hope for the future. But not All Are As inspiring As the Graceful domed Jef Ferson memorial or As heart wrenching As the Black Granite Wall commemorating those who died in Vietnam. Some of the More obscure memorials might leave tourists scratching their Heads like the Temperance Fountain on Pennsylvania Avenue that or. Henry Cogswell erected to persuade people to quench their thirst with water not rum particularly since the Fountain has not worked i years. And if you like Many assume that the Ericsson statue on the mall was erected in Honor of Leif the Early explorer you would be wrong. It commemorates John Ericsson inventor of the inter screw propeller. Therein lies a problem a finite amount of space and a potentially infinite number of requests for new memorials. We have an unprecedented number of pending proposals 17 this year alone awaiting congressional consideration said Patty Kennedy a member of the Senate Energy and natural resources subcommittee on Public lands. They include memorials for Martin Luther King the longstanding Friendship Between the United states and Morocco the american tank division women in the armed forces Black patriots who fought in the american revolution the korean conflict and Gen. Draza Mihailo Vich who saved 500 . Airmen in Yugoslavia during world War ii. B. If we were to enact All of those this year we would take care of about half of the remaining Sites for All time Kennedy said. There also have been requests but no legislation for a memorial honouring the seven astronauts who died when the space shuttle challenger exploded in february. House Interior committee chairman Morris Udall d ariz., has introduced a Bill to establish guidelines for decision making on future memorials. His panel s National Parks subcommittee will hold a hearing on the subject april 15. The Senate Public lands subcommittee held similar hearings last month and chairman Malcolm Wallop r wyo., also plans to introduce legislation to restrict future monuments. A Dales Bill would prohibit any new monuments on the main mall area of the capital the Grassy area that stretches from the Lincoln memorial East to the Capitol. It would restrict future War memorials to honouring com plete branches of the service like the army or Navy or commemorating an entire conflict like the korean War rather than a specific military division or Battle. To ensure that the proposed memorials stand the test of time the Bill would require that at least 25 years pass after the death of a person before he or she could be honoured with a memorial in the nation s capital. And in some cases a statue would be displayed in Washington Only temporarily before being moved to its permanent Home elsewhere in the country. Finally the legislation would direct private groups to raise the Money for the construction of future memorials As Well As provide for their maintenance. San Diego zoo plans Roundup of prolific fowl running free san Diego a zoo officials plan to curb hundreds of chickens turkeys and other assorted fowl that have gone too far in their scavenging. Keepers armed with nets and traps will scour the 100 acre Park rounding up the Birds. They then will relocate a Small group of the Healthiest ones into the zoo s three canyons and will try to find Homes for the rest. Chicken free zones will be established near food stands and in other areas where the Birds hang around waiting for handouts said spokesman Jeff Jouett. There Are about 500 chickens 120 australian Brush turkeys and assorted wild fowl now running free. They descended from 27 Birds the zoo let Loose in 1942. The 200 Gallons tested revealed no unusual or foreign substance Crisp said. Survey of sunken whaling ship reveals Only minor damage Gold Beach Ore. A a group that wants to restore the sunken Mary d. Hume the last of the steam powered Arctic whaling ships found Only minor damage when they examined the Hull. Thousands of Gallons of water were pumped from the ship a Short distance up the rogue River from Gold Beach said Walt Schroeder president of the Curry county historical society. The to Crew found one Hole and another possible Hole inthe 98-foot wooden Hull he said. The 105-year-old vessel Sank in november while Mem oers of the society were trying to put it on a special Cradle designed to protect it from storms. The Cradle broke dumping the boat in the River where us 05 y submerged. The group Hopes to raise the vessel and repair it once a Moorage can be found
